4 weeks for a fill too long

I'm 3 1/2 months post op & I have a 10cc band & I'm at 7.2cc so frustrating because I haven't lost a large amount of weight because I'm not at the green zone...I have starting riding my bike & walking almost everyday & trying to eat healthy but geez I got the lapband so I won't be hungry all the time & eat less but just isn't happening for me :(

I know it's a slow process and I'm losing inches not a lot of weight and I know loosing weight slower is better but it is so frustrating. When people know I've had the LapBand done they expect me to lose a lot of weight or to be skinny. I hate eating around people because I still or looks like I still eat the same when I'm supposed to eat smaller.

Does anyone still have left shoulder pain or has ever experience that??? I was told it was gas pains but that was after surgery & then after that they said it was a nerve that was near the band that sends signals to the brain when we're full. Seems like every morning I am waking up w/ it & sometimes feel that if when I'm eating and I start getting full. I went for my fill yesterday and they would not give me a fill because I was complaining about the shoulder pain The nurse said I had a go see a cardiologist & I was like WTH it's not chest pains it's shoulder pain that goes away the same pain after surgery and the same pain that I've explained to the nurse and they told me about the nerve that was there and this nurse looked at me like she didn't know what I was talking about so she did not give me a fill. I understand when she heard me complain about my left shoulder pain she was concerned & just a precaution to see the cardiologist but just wondering if anyone else have this problem???

I still get the left shoulder pain and i had my surgery on july 16 th. It happens if i eat too fast or dont chew well enough. I still havent quite gotten the slow down and chew good thing down yet but i am getting there. I have lost 40 pounds since surgery day and i am at 8.5 cc in a 14cc band, had 3rd fill.
